The process of converting between Celsius and Fahrenheit is relatively straightforward, thanks to the formulas that have been established. To convert Celsius to Fahrenheit, one uses the formula: Fahrenheit = (Celsius * 9/5) + 32. Conversely, to convert Fahrenheit to Celsius, the formula is: Celsius = (Fahrenheit - 32) * 5/9. Applying these formulas to a temperature like 36.5 degrees Celsius can help individuals quickly determine its equivalent in Fahrenheit, which is essential for communication and understanding across different regions and industries. Understanding the Celsius Scale
Key Features of the Celsius Scale
The Celsius scale has several key features that make it widely used: - It is based on the decimal system, making calculations straightforward. - The scale is divided into 100 equal parts between the freezing and boiling points of water, providing a simple and logical framework for measuring temperature. - It is used in most scientific applications due to its simplicity and the logical division of the temperature range.Introduction to the Fahrenheit Scale
Characteristics of the Fahrenheit Scale
Some notable characteristics of the Fahrenheit scale include: - It has a different zero point and scale interval compared to the Celsius scale. - The freezing point of water is 32 degrees, and the boiling point is 212 degrees, making it less straightforward for some calculations. - Despite its less common use globally, it remains prevalent in certain regions and industries.Converting 36.5 Celsius to Fahrenheit
Steps for Conversion
The steps for converting Celsius to Fahrenheit are as follows: 1. Multiply the Celsius temperature by 9. 2. Divide the result by 5. 3. Add 32 to the result.Practical Applications of Temperature Conversion
